Ultimele tutoriale de dezvoltare web
 

ADO IsolationLevel Property


<Complet de referință obiect de conexiune

Seturile de proprietate IsolationLevel sau returnează nivelul de izolare a unui obiect Connection. Valoarea este o IsolationLevelEnum valoare. Implicit este adXactChaos.

Note: Setările IsolationLevel nu va funcționa până BeginTrans Data viitoare când se numește.

Sintaxă

objconn.IsolationLevel

Exemplu

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.IsolationLevel=adXactIsolated
conn.Open(Server.Mappath("northwind.mdb"))

response.write(conn.IsolationLevel)

conn.Close
%>

IsolationLevelEnum

Constant Valoare Descriere
adXactUnspecified-1 Nu se poate utiliza nivelul de izolare specificat, deoarece furnizorul utilizează un nivel de izolare diferit, iar acest nivel nu poate fi determinat.
adXactChaos16 Nu se poate suprascrie tranzacții de nivel superior.
adXactBrowse256 Pot vedea modificările neangajate în alte tranzacții.
adXactReadUncommitted256 La fel ca adXactBrowse.
adXactCursorStability4096 Poate vizualiza modificările comise în alte tranzacții.
adXactReadCommitted4096 La fel ca adXactCursorStability.
adXactRepeatableRead65536 Nu pot vedea schimbări în alte tranzacții, dar puteți reinterogare
adXactIsolated1048576 Tranzacțiile sunt izolate de toate celelalte tranzacții.
adXactSerializable1048576 La fel ca adXactIsolated.

<Complet de referință obiect de conexiune